What is e-Agriculture.org?

e-agriculture.org is a global initiative to enhance sustainable agricultural development and food security by improving the use of information, communication, and associated technologies in the sector. 

The overall aim is to enable members to exchange opinions, experiences, good practices and resources related to e-agriculture, and to ensure that the knowledge created is effectively shared and used worldwide.    more... 

 

Virtual Forum "Mobile Telephony in Rural Areas" has concluded - but we look forward to your continued input!

Thank you to the over 150 community members from over 50 countries who participated in this exciting forum!

This Forum examined the challenges that rural communities face in enhancing the benefits of mobile telephony, and looked at some examples of interesting initiatives and good outcomes from around the globe.
